Output 39f67efcc2a4a5ea1ca792e39e8741fbcba003b38340ad49567368f8b45fcc42:0

value
1666681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b63ccc0cc18b6e037bbae294238edbce73d5fbb3 OP_EQUAL
address
3JJbjiDDcNvSyHpP5EqEjM7PKmpPxLLPzA
transaction
39f67efcc2a4a5ea1ca792e39e8741fbcba003b38340ad49567368f8b45fcc42
spent
true